THE IRON GIANT FROM THE COUNTRY OF


GOD

Over 200 years ago researchers once located a


legendary “iron giant” that attacked Mary
Geoise. Its manufacture date matched the time
of 900 years ago when a certain immense
kingdom existed, being the kingdom of Joy
Boy’s people.

Really though, the far more important question


is WHY exactly this giant robot would be found
in… Mary Geoise of all places?? After all it is a
robot, so it is not something it did of its own
will but rather something that it was
programmed to do, especially with the
precedents we’ve seen in the One Piece world
such as how Kuma was programmed to protect
the Thousand Sunny for two years. This means
that the robot was programmed to attack Mary
Geoise way prior to its reawakening 200 years
ago. But if it was made 900 years ago, then
things just doesn’t add up, because back then…
Mary Geoise did not yet exist. After all the city
was founded 800 years ago as the Void Century
ended… meaning the robot was not
programmed to attack Mary Geoise but rather
what existed there at the top of the Red Line
before it.

We can also see in the depiction of when it


attacked Mary Geoise 200 years ago that the
robot already had battle damage, such as
missing a horn or having a katana lodged on its
chest, meaning that it already entered a battle
long ago prior to these events, so it is likely
that 900 years ago it was defeated in what is
now Mary Geoise and fell in battle right there.
During that time it’s possible that the robot
either remained hidden underground
somewhere beneath Mary Geoise or more likely
outright fell off the Red Line all together as it
was defeated and sank into the sea, which
would explain why it is covered in moss and
how it managed to remain hidden all this time.
After all we saw how the Vega Force could move
through water and air, so maybe 200 years ago
something reactivated its circuits and it
climbed back up the Red Line all the way to the
top as Franky suggested. At that point it
followed its programming again to attack the
top of the Red Line, so it then launched an
assault on what was now Mary Geoise. However
its lack of the very little energy it had left
meant that it deactivated pretty quickly,
causing it to collapse right then and there
before it could cause any real damage to the
city or its people.

But then, what was in place of Mary Geoise at


the top of the Red Line before the city was
founded that this robot might’ve wanted to
attack? Well… we already know! We’ve been
told exactly what lied up there: before Mary
Geoise, on top of the Red Line, there existed a
settlement known as the the “Country of God”,
or the “God Country”. This was said to be
where the tribe known as the Lunaria once
lived. The Lunaria of course were incredibly
powerful beings, being tall imposing figures
with dark skins that were incredibly durable,
wings that allowed them to fly freely unlike
other wingedfolk, and fire on their backs that
would burn forever. The settlement that
belonged at the top of the Red Line was the
God Country of the Lunaria.

Now the question here as Vegapunk posed is


what was the robot’s purpose. I think
ultimately it can be boiled to one of two: either
one, it was set to attack the top of the Red Line
because it was ordered to do so, or two it tried
to defend the top of the Red Line by chasing
away the intruders who were not part of its
people, whom it detected as enemies. So which
one is the case? Well if we go by the first
theory, attacking the country, then that would
mean that the Lunaria were the enemies of Joy
Boy, but that doesn’t quite make sense because
King mentioned that the Lunaria were waiting
for the new Joy Boy to arrive, so clearly the two
were allies. In other words, it would mean that
the second theory is likely what actually
happened, that the robot was there to protect
the top of the Red Line from their enemies.
And seeing humans at the top, it tried to drive
them away with its spear to drive them off its
homeland.

But then… do you realize what that means? Do


you realize the massive implications of this? It
means that the God Country was where this
robot originated from. Or in other words the
God Country would be the ancient kingdom.

Now this doesn’t necessarily mean that the God


Country was the entirety of the ancient
kingdom. After all, as Clover explained, the
kingdom was “massive” in size, which likely
referred to the fact that it had allies, or in
simpler terms, “nakama”, all around the world,
such as the Shandians, the Seafolk, or the
Minks among others. So the Lunaria could also
be counted among those allies, since after all
they too were an oppressed race much like all
the aforementioned that were persecuted by
humans. But no doubt the God Country served
as a key location for the immense kingdom.

And once you start thinking about it, you might


realize how this has made perfect sense all
along. I mean after all this ancient kingdom
possessed incredibly advanced technology way
ahead of its time, but where did this technology
originate from? As we saw in Enel’s cover story,
the Moon. And the Lunaria are people from the
Moon, as not only do they have wings, but it’s
even in the name, as “Luna” is Latin for
“Moon”. So quite simply the Lunaria could be
the ones that brought this technology to the
God Country that allowed Joy Boy’s people to
be so advanced. This would also explain what
Vegapunk mentioned about how these
inventions required a particular fuel force he
was trying to replicate, being “fire”. If
Vegapunk could only have an eternal flame that
never went out then he could quite literally
make a sun that would power all of this
technology… and what are the creatures that
have perennially burning flames on their
backs? The Lunaria, who with their flames
could power all of this technology for the
kingdom. This would explain why Vegapunk
stated that the 900-year-old iron giant found in
Mary Geoise 200 years ago helped prove the
theory that the ancient kingdom existed,
because they were one and the same.

Advertisements

REPORT THIS AD

This would explain why the Lunaria have white


hair, just like Nika. This would explain why
when Oda drew a young King in an SBS he drew
him with a spear just like Nika. This would
explain why Whitebeard knew about the “God
Country”’s existence since Roger did tell him
about the people of this ancient kingdom. And
this would explain above all else why it was
called the “God Country”… because its king,
the king of this kingdom was Joy Boy… or the
Sun God Nika, and the ancient kingdom the
country of this god and the other Lunaria who
were also called gods.

And this could even explain why the massive


tree that stretches from its roots at Fishman
Island all the way up across the Red Line to
supposedly the top where the God Country
once was… is called the “Sun Tree Eve”. And
according to the story of Genesis from the
Bible, Eve was the one who was tempted by the
Devil to eat the devil fruits from the forbidden
tree. So if the ancient kingdom, with its
advanced technology, was able to create the
very first devil fruits through the application of
the bloodline elements/lineage factor, in the
same way that Vegapunk has been able to apply
that technology to replicate fruits now, then it
makes sense that those devil fruits were
originally developed in the God Country where
the ancient kingdom existed, being made to
grow where else but on the Sun Tree Eve. Could
this mythical tree venerated by its people also
be reflected in their culture, which is why
King’s real name is Alber, which translates to
“tree”.

All of this could finally help us understand how


the 20 human kingdoms that allied together
came into conflict against Joy Boy, explaining
just as Vegapunk put it how the Void Century is
a history of a war between this country and 20
human kingdoms. As we know, the allied
powers won and defeated the God Country,
replacing its people, who were known as gods,
and taking their place. This would explain why
the Government is so keen on persecuting the
Lunaria, even more than any other species,
such as offering 100 million belly to anyone
who would even tip them about the existence
of one. To put it into perspective that’s a
massive amount of money, the same amount
that could buy you a devil fruit or a large
bounty, so the Government is clearly very
interested in their erasure. They eliminated the
immense kingdom that they feared so much,
wiping away their ideals from history so that
their dreams and ideals would be forgotten, and
then seizing the God Country for themselves,
building Mary Geoise in its place and becoming
the new “gods” of the world, essentially seizing
the spoils of victory and replacing the Lunaria.
And, hear me out, could this be the reason why
Mary Geoise is pronounced the same as “joie”,
which translates to “joy”, while “Mary” comes
from Latin “sea”.

Eitherway, the Lunaria stopped being called


“gods” and instead now the “gods” were the
Celestial Dragons, naming themselves as such
after the dragons that they venerated, believing
to be the new gods of the world. As such, the
descendants of the immense kingdom, who
came to be known as the D. Clan, the fateful
people of the Dawn, became now known by a
different name… “the divine enemies of the
gods”.

As Rosinante put it, in this case the gods would


be the Celestial Dragons, meaning that the
people of the D. oppose the Celestial Dragons,
intending to destroy the world, but as he
clarifies this is not a destruction meant in a
negative sense, like the one that a tyrant would
bring. Rather, it is a destruction that is meant
to change the world for the better.
